A 3-year position as PhD student is available at the Department of Medical Genetics, Oslo University Hospital. The position will be associated with the ‘breast cancer heterogeneity and oncoimmunology’ project group (https://www.ous-research.no/tekpli) and is financed by the Norwegian Health authorities through the project: "Spatial and longitudinal analyses of single cells in breast tumors to characterize and overcome resistance to therapies".
The lab has longstanding collaborations with oncologists at Oslo University Hospital (OUH) and Akershus University Hospital (Ahus) and conducts translational research in numerous clinical trials. Currently, through our collaborations with oncologists we have an ambitious new initiative aiming at merging the exciting new field of single-cell analysis with clinical studies.
The past 2-3 years, we have performed single cell RNA sequencing (scRNA-seq) and spatial transcriptomics (ST) on tumor biopsies sampled at different time points of neoadjuvant therapy. Currently, the major focus of the lab is to use single cell technologies to understand which exact cell types /phenotypes are sensitive or resistant to therapies and to characterize how the tumor microenvironment determines tumor behavior and response to cancer therapies.
The Department of Medical Genetics at Oslo University Hospital is Norway’s largest medical genetics department with over 200 employees. The department is responsible for diagnostics of rare and inherited diseases, and runs a national research infrastructure for high-throughput DNA sequencing at the Norwegian Consortium for Sequencing and Personalized Medicine (www.norseq.org) . The research section in the department has 7 research groups (www.ous-research.no/meg/) working in various fields of medical genetics, including genetics, epigenetics, bioinformatics and functional genetics of breast cancer, autoimmune diseases, neurological, cardiovascular and psychiatricdisorders.
